Nemom is a suburb of Thiruvananthapuram, the capital city of Kerala, India.

It is surrounded by Thirumala in the north, Malayinkeezhu in the north-east, Balaramapuram in the south-east, Kovalam in the south and Thiruvallam in the west. Nemom falls within the municipal corporation of Thiruvananthapuram, though partly exclusive. It is connected with Thiruvananthapuram, Neyyattinkara, Vizhinjam, Poovar, Kattakkada, Nagarcoil, and Kanyakumari through the main arterial highway National Highway 66.

Nemom has a Government Ayurveda Clinic.[1] There is a public market at Pravachambalam, about one kilometre away from Nemom.[citation needed] Vellayani Devi Temple[2] is located in Nemom.

Parliamentary and Assembly constituencies

[edit | edit source]

Nemom is part of Nemom Assembly constituency and Thiruvananthapuram Parliamentary constituency. After the 2024 Indian general election, Shashi Tharoor, MP [3] of Indian National Congress represents Thiruvananthapuram in Lok Sabha. V. Sivankutty, MLA of Communist Party of India (Marxist) is representing Nemom Assembly constituency in the Kerala Legislative Assembly after 2021 assembly election. He is also the present Minister for General Education and Labour, Government of Kerala.

City corporation

[edit | edit source]

Nemom consists of 2 wards of Thiruvananthapuram Corporation. The 54th ward is named Nemom, and the 55th is named Ponnumangalam. After the 2025 Kerala local elections, Sridevi S K of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) is the present councilor of the Ponnumangalam Corporation Division. Senior BJP leader M.R. Gopan is the councilor of Nemom Corporation Division[4]. M.R. Gopan is the previous Leader of the Opposition in the Thiruvananthapuram Municipal Corporation during 2020-25 period[5].

Taluk

[edit | edit source]

Nemom village comes under Thiruvananthapuram taluk of the four taluks of Thiruvananthapuram district namely Chirayinkeezhu, Neyyattinkara, Nedumangad and Thiruvananthapuram.

Other major establishments

[edit | edit source]
  • Merryland Studio,[16] the second film studio in Kerala, which played important roles in the history of Malayalam cinema, was opened in 1951 by veteran director-producer P. Subramaniam.
  • Venus Engineering Works & Foundry Ltd., which is a bicycle parts manufacturing division of Metro Exporters, Mumbai.
